Taxonomic Classification
| Rank | Black-eared Deermouse | Powdered Flat-body |
|---|---|---|
| Kingdom same | Animalia (Animals) | Animalia (Animals) |
| Phylum | Chordata (Chordates) | Arthropoda (Arthropods) |
| Class | Mammalia (Mammals) | Insecta (Insects) |
| Order | Rodentia (Rodents) | Lepidoptera (Butterflies & Moths) |
| Family | Cricetidae | Depressariidae |
| Genus | Peromyscus | Agonopterix |
| Species | Peromyscus melanotis | Agonopterix curvipunctosa |
